Molecular identification of Pilobolus species from Yellowstone National Park.

K Michael Foos1, Kathy B Sheehan.   

Abstract

Pilobolus, a widely distributed coprophilous fungus, grows on herbivore dung. Species of Pilobolus traditionally are described with imprecise morphological characteristics potentially leading to misidentification. In this study we used PCR analysis of taxonomically informative sequences to provide more consistent species identification from isolates obtained in Yellowstone National Park. We collected Pilobolus park-wide from six taxa of herbivores over 9 y. Multiple transfers of single sporangium isolates provided pure cultures from which DNA was extracted. Sequence analysis of internal transcribed spacer (ITS) regions of DNA that code for rRNA genes were used to distinguish among similar species. We describe several species of Pilobolus associated with herbivores in various habitats, including two species not previously reported, P. heterosporus and P. sphaerosporus. Our results show that phylogenetic species identification of Pilobolus based on sequence analysis of pure culture isolates provides a more reliable means of identifying species than traditional methods.
